Cat's Eyes - Green Operculum - DG079 |


|
These are great little decorative shells
which can be used in rings, bracelets, picture frames and many more craft ideas. "Operculum"
means "little lid" and these shells would have acted as a trap door to help
protect the aperture of the shell. They do look like cats' eyes too, although no two
are ever exactly the same.

Shell Buttons |

|
Our assorted
real shell buttons come in sizes varying from half an inch
to an inch and in an assortment of the colours you can see
in the images. Vibrant colours incorporating pearl and abalone
shells. Shell buttons have been used for decorative purposes
dating back thousands of years to the times of the Indus Valley
civilization. They would pierce holes in the shells and use
them on clothing as decorative rather than for fastening purposes.
